INDIAN WELLS – This desert resort community, home to about 5,400 people, has been attracting coveted national press attention that some other communities can only dream about.

Indian Wells, which hosts the sixth-largest tennis tournament in the world, currently known as the BNP Paribas Open, made headlines in Forbes on Jan. 6 as a “Trendy Coachella Destination with a Delano Hotel and Residences.”

The $85 million project, which is set to open in the desert in 2020, will include 154 hotel rooms and 59 Delano-branded residential condominium units.

“With an increase of younger millennial consumers, SBE is hoping its $85 million project will create a wave of new energy for the city and offer new options for travelers,” Jim Dobson wrote in the Forbes article.

“For decades Indian Wells has been a world-renowned vacation destination,” Indian Wells City Councilmember Dana Reed told Uken Report. “Publicity like this shows everyone we are not resting on our laurels. We are not your grandfather’s Indian Wells anymore.”

SBE, a leading international hospitality group that develops manages and operates award-winning global hospitality brands, in October announced a partnership with investment and development company TMC Group and Managing Partner Philip Bates to bring the iconic Delano brand to California’s sought-after desert oasis,

Indian Wells. Delano Hotel & Residences Indian Wells mark the first iteration for the brand in California, and the first Delano with a residential component in the USA.

“Bringing the iconic Delano brand, along with SBE and its entire platform, to this magnificent site in Indian Wells will transform and energize the entire Coachella Valley,” said Philip Bates, Managing Partner, TMC Group.  “Delano Indian Wells is going to break the mold, redefining and elevating how people stay, eat and are entertained in the Coachella Valley.”

Delano Hotel & Residences, Indian Wells will also feature premier culinary offerings with Katsuya, a culinary concept by SBE and celebrity Chef Katsuya Uechi. The restaurant will bring signature favorites along with new items created especially for the desert location. For an indulgent escape, SBE will also introduce their iconic SKYBAR concept to Indian Wells, a day-to-night pool deck showcasing the exclusive and chic atmosphere the brand is known for.

As with every SBE hotel, Delano’s recognizable design point-of-view will be visible throughout the property with sophistication and ease blending with timeless design.
